TPO roof installation services involve the setup of a thermoplastic polyolefin (TPO) roofing membrane on a property's roof. This type of roofing is known for its durability, energy efficiency, and resistance to weathering, making it a popular choice for many commercial and residential properties. The process typically includes preparing the existing roof surface, installing insulation if needed, and then applying the TPO membrane securely to create a seamless, waterproof barrier. Skilled contractors ensure that the installation is performed correctly to maximize the roof’s lifespan and performance.
This service helps address common roofing problems such as leaks, cracks, and deterioration caused by age or exposure to the elements. Over time, roofs can develop vulnerabilities that lead to water intrusion and interior damage. TPO roofing provides a reliable solution by offering a strong, flexible membrane that can withstand high winds, UV rays, and temperature fluctuations. Installing a TPO roof can effectively prevent water leaks, reduce energy costs through reflective properties, and improve the overall integrity of the building’s roof structure.
TPO roof installation is suitable for a variety of property types, including commercial buildings, warehouses, industrial facilities, and some residential flat-roofed homes. These roofs are often chosen for their ability to cover large, flat or low-slope surfaces efficiently.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or TPO roof repairs range from $250-$600. Many routine patching or sealing j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age and roof size.
Partial Repairs - for larger sections needing repair, costs generally range from $600-$2,000. These projects often involve replacing sections of the TPO membrane and are common for moderate damage.
Full Roof Replacement - complete TPO roof replacements usually cost between $5,000-$12,000, with larger or more complex projects reaching higher costs. Many full replacements fall into the middle of this range, depending on roof size and complexity.
Complex or Custom Projects - highly detailed or extensive TPO roofing projects can exceed $15,000, especially for large commercial buildings or intricate roof designs. Fewer projects reach this tier, but costs can vary based on specific requ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a TPO roof? A TPO roof is a type of single-pply membrane roofing made from thermoplastic polyolefin, commonly used for commercial and residential flat roofs.
Why choose TPO roofing for a new installation? TPO roofing offers durability, energy efficiency, and resistance to UV rays, making it a popular choice for long-lasting flat roof solutions.
What should I consider when hiring a contractor for TPO roof installation? It's important to find local contractors experienced with TPO systems who can ensure proper installation and adherence to building standards.
How do local service providers typically install TPO roofs? They usually prepare the roof surface, roll out the TPO membrane, and secure it with heat-welding techniques to create a seamless, waterproof layer.
Are there different types of TPO roofing membranes? Yes, TPO membranes come in various thicknesses and formulations, allowing contractors to select the best option for specific building needs.
